Abstract: 南極大陸とその周辺に存在する山地,海岸,海底の地形・地質には,過去の南極氷床の盛衰が様々な形で記録されている.これらの記録は,断片的ではあるが,過去の南極氷床の空間的な分布範囲や拡大・縮小過程,当時の氷床底環境などを復元するうえで,他の地球科学的手法では得ることができない独特のデータを提供する.本稿では,地形地質学的に復元された最終氷期最盛期以降の南極氷床融氷史に関する成果の概要と今後の課題を示す.
The Antarctic Ice Sheet history has been recorded on various sediments and rocks of the mountains, coasts and the ocean floor of Antarctica and its surroundings. Although these geomorphological and geological records are fragmentary, they provide unique data for reconstruction of the spatial expansion range, shrinking process and thermal subglacial environments of the past Antarctic Ice sheet. In this paper, we present the outline of the knowledge and understanding of the Antarctic Ice Sheets at the Last Glacial Maximum (LGM) and their subsequent changes throughout the Holocene.
